A student with a physical disability attends all classes with their peers and receives additional support from a paraprofessional.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is 'Inclusion' because the student is fully participating in classes with additional support, which aligns with the principles of inclusion.

A student with autism spends part of their day in a resource room for specialized instruction in reading and math but joins the general education classroom for science and social studies.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is mainstreaming because the student is receiving specialized instruction in a separate setting for part of the day and joining the general education classroom for other subjects.

A student with a hearing impairment uses a sign language interpreter in a general education classroom and participates in all school activities.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is Inclusion because the student with a hearing impairment is fully participating in all school activities with the support of a sign language interpreter in a general education classroom.

A student with learning disabilities is placed in a general education classroom full-time and the curriculum is adapted to meet their needs.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is Inclusion because the student with learning disabilities is fully integrated into the general education classroom with adapted curriculum.

A student with emotional disturbances attends a general education class but is pulled out for behavioral therapy sessions twice a week.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is mainstreaming because the student is attending a general education class and receiving additional support outside the classroom.

A student with Down syndrome is fully integrated into a general education classroom and the teacher uses differentiated instruction to cater to all students.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
The correct choice is 'Inclusion' because the student with Down syndrome is fully integrated into the general education classroom, which is a key aspect of inclusion.

A student with dyslexia receives one-on-one reading instruction in a separate setting but participates in all other general education classes with their peers. Is this inclusion or mainstreaming?
Inclusion
Mainstreaming
Answer explanation
This is mainstreaming because the student is receiving specialized instruction in a separate setting for one subject but is included in all other general education classes with peers.
